Transaction 3cf01af79a0d99cf32e2a09f7e626b9ada82240440f7ae71ba534cef036d6547
1 Input
1 Output
-
3cf01af79a0d99cf32e2a09f7e626b9ada82240440f7ae71ba534cef036d6547:0
- value
- 19596756
- script pubkey
- OP_0 OP_PUSHBYTES_20 e0a8f5a581250598995014d4ad8fd4418650edfd
- address
- bc1quz50tfvpy5ze3x2szn22mr75gxr9pm0a5358jy